Output 666e8baffe046ff9fde9743a8c446baa77d577e26c5aea4a9b485af334a35d19:24

value
620539
script pubkey
OP_0 OP_PUSHBYTES_20 03e16ecabdb69e4c2829ee18e02f03022dcdda01
address
bc1qq0skaj4ak60yc2pfacvwqtcrqgkumksppx962e
transaction
666e8baffe046ff9fde9743a8c446baa77d577e26c5aea4a9b485af334a35d19
spent
true